I would like to wish all NAAHP members and prospective members a Happy New Year and thank you for your continuous support. We have a very exciting year ahead for our members where your involvement will be the key and main ingredient for our success.

As a professional organization one of our core values and objectives has been to provide a platform for networking opportunities. We are achieving this goal through several networking events at designated cities, as well as, through our annual conferences. I thank you from the bottom of my heart for your participation and your support at these events. We promise to deliver even more this year!

You will soon receive a brief survey to help us assess and have your voices heard in our strategic plan for member services. As we begin this new year I am excited to announce that we are also starting a new chapter in NAAHP with direct focus on the professional development of our members.   The organization as a whole will be a champion of this initiative, which will be reflected in our monthly newsletter editions with a new “Career Conversation” section to uplift, boost and inspire your professional growth. In addition, we will partner with institutions that will offer amazing discounts on specialized professional training and certifications for our members. National Alliance for the Advancement of Haitian Professionals

NAAHP is focused on connecting a global community of peers with career advancement resources as well as fostering transformative relationships to strengthen Haiti through philanthropy and social entrepreneurship.
